Apple (Nasdaq: AAPL) products are not banned in China, according to reports from AppleInsider, citing Caixin.
Headlines are in response to rumors and report its products were excluded from a list of products that can be purchased by the government. One person familiar with the situation said Apple's exclusion from a semi-annual "shopping list" is far from a formal ban and may be a simple filing error. Authorities are looking into the matter, said AppleInsider.
